  • It wasn’t a win, but the Caps closed out the preseason on a decent note, and with few glaring concerns, and few health issues — knock on wood. Sadly, the next four-plus days are likely to crawl along as we await the final roster tweaks and finally get to see the new, improved Caps on the ice.

    Edit from Gustafsson: This was the game you could receive a free ticket by presenting a DC United ticket stub to the box office.  The ticket I received was in Section 120, Row O, a $95 face value.  Certainly not a bad value.
